//请求头Axios.create创建之前做判断,拿到接口中配置的属性,设置请求头为config.headers={'Content-Type': options.ContentType} console.log(options.ContentType) if(options.ContentType){ config.headers = { 'Content-Type': options.ContentType } } const axios = Axios.create({ baseURL: config.baseUrl...
headers: {'Content-Type': 'multipart/form-data',//文章说参数放到其他地方后端拿不到,所以把参数 projectId 放在头部传递'projectId':this.projectId }, data:fd }) .then(res=>res.json()) .then(res=>{console.log(res)}) .catch(function(e) { console.log("error"); }); } 后来发现这样还...
<template><el-uploadaction="' '"list-type="picture-card":limit="3"show-file-list:auto-upload="false":on-change="change"multiple></el-upload><el-dialog:visible.sync="dialogVisible"></el-dialog>提交</template>import axios from "axios"; //数据请求 export default { data() { return { ...
post('https://your-upload-endpoint.com/upload', formData, { headers: { 'Content-Type': 'multipart/form-data' } }) .then(response => { if (response.data.success) { resolve(response.data); } else { reject(new Error(response.data.message)); } }) .catch(error => { reject(...
header('Access-Control-Allow-Headers:x-requested-with,content-type'); //响应头 而我出现的问题就是,没有做options 判断返回或过滤掉,而是直接接受获取,导致接受到的文件为空报错。 所以正确的做法应该是直接做options头判断,返回就可以了。
); } return isJPG && isLt2M; }, submit() { let config = { timeout: 30000, headers: { "Content-Type": "multipart/form-data", //设置headers }, }; const formData = new FormData(); var that = this; // 首先判断是否上传了图片,如果上传了图片,将图片存入到formData中 console.log(this...
首先,让我们来看看模板部分的代码:附件:<el-upload v-if="item.canEdit" ref="upload" :action="/upLoad" @remove="remove" :headers="{'content-type':'application/x-www-form-urlencoded'}" :http-request="upLoad" @preview="previewFile" :file-list="item.addons"> <...
// axiosimportaxiosfrom'axios'import{storage,sessionStorage}from'@/utils/storage'import{Message}from'element-ui'importrouterfrom'../router/index'constservice=axios.create({baseURL:process.env.VUE_APP_BASE_URL,timeout:5000,// 设置超时时间headers:{'Content-Type':'application/json; charset=utf-8'...
--文件名-->formData.append('fileName',this.upload.fileName);<!--自定义上传-->axios.post(this.upload.url,formData,{headers:{'Content-Type':'multipart/form-data',Authorization:getToken()}}).then(response=>{if(response.code==200){this.upload.open=false;this.upload.isUploading=false;this....
headers: { 'Content-Type': 'application/x-www-form-urlencoded', 'Access-Control-Allow-Origin': '*', } }).then((response) => { if (response.status == 200) { let policyData = response.data; console.log(policyData); /** ossUrl 换成自己的Bucket的外网地址, ...